Claudia Claros is a PhD Candidate at McGill studying sensemaking and misinformation. Her dissertation, “To know we don’t”, investigates cognitive and behavioral processes of truth discernment and susceptibility to misinformation. She holds a BA in Philosophy and Modern Languages and an MA in Digital Curation. Her interests center on the relationship between personal and social epistemology and consciousness.
